1. U.S. Indictment; 'The Corrupt Solar Project' | World Business Watch | World News

    U.S. Indictment; 'The Corrupt Solar Project' | World Business Watch | World News

    22
  2. Sports News today 2024. Watch now

    Sports News today 2024. Watch now

    5
  3. Shadows Over Saint Petersburg: What’s Stirring in Russia Today?

    Shadows Over Saint Petersburg: What’s Stirring in Russia Today?

    15
    0
    1.38K
    3